The phosphate remover market is increasingly crucial as the demand for water purification and maintenance grows, especially in residential and commercial sectors. Phosphate removers play an important role in mitigating the negative effects of phosphate buildup in aquatic environments, especially in pools, spas, and water treatment facilities. Phosphate is a key contributor to algae growth and water degradation, which makes its removal essential for maintaining clean and safe water. Phosphate removers work by binding to phosphates and precipitating them, thereby facilitating their removal from water. The “Others” segment in the phosphate remover market includes a range of specialized applications outside residential and commercial pools. These applications encompass industries such as aquaculture, wastewater treatment plants, and industrial water systems. In aquaculture, phosphate removal is essential to maintaining optimal water quality for fish farms, where excessive phosphates can lead to undesirable algae blooms that negatively impact fish health and farm productivity. In wastewater treatment, phosphate removers are critical in reducing nutrient pollution, which is a major cause of eutrophication in rivers and lakes. Phosphate removal technologies are employed in various industrial water management systems, where controlling phosphate levels ensures the operational efficiency of cooling systems, boilers, and other machinery. This broadens the market’s potential, with phosphate removal products being utilized in a wide range of industries that require the removal of excess nutrients from water bodies.
As global environmental standards tighten, the demand for phosphate removers in the "Others" segment is increasing due to regulatory pressures on industries to reduce nutrient discharge into natural water bodies. Wastewater treatment facilities, for example, face stringent regulations regarding nutrient removal, and phosphate removers play a critical role in meeting these standards. Additionally, industries such as food processing, pharmaceuticals, and power generation are adopting phosphate removal solutions to ensure water quality and maintain compliance with environmental regulations. What is the role of phosphate removers in pool maintenance?
Phosphate removers help prevent algae growth by removing excess phosphates, ensuring clean and clear pool water.
Are phosphate removers safe to use in residential pools?
Yes, most phosphate removers designed for residential pools are safe to use when applied according to the manufacturer's instructions.
Can phosphate removers be used in saltwater pools?
Yes, there are phosphate removers available that are effective for both freshwater and saltwater pools.
How often should phosphate removers be used in a residential pool?
Phosphate removers should be used periodically, depending on the phosphate levels and water conditions in the pool.
What are the benefits of using phosphate removers in commercial pools?
Phosphate removers help reduce algae growth and maintain water clarity, which is essential for high-traffic commercial pools.
Do phosphate removers affect the pH balance of pool water?
High-quality phosphate removers typically do not significantly alter the pH balance when used as directed.
Are phosphate removers environmentally friendly?
Many phosphate removers are now formulated to be biodegradable and environmentally safe, reducing their impact on the ecosystem.
What industries use phosphate removers apart from pools?
Phosphate removers are used in wastewater treatment, aquaculture, and various industrial water management systems.
How do phosphate removers improve water quality in pools?
By removing excess phosphates, phosphate removers prevent algae blooms, leading to clearer and healthier pool water.
Can phosphate removers be used in aquariums?
Yes, phosphate removers can be used in aquariums to reduce algae growth and maintain optimal water quality for fish and other aquatic life.
